Rapid drying device for powder metallurgy oil bearing machining

By using a hot air blower and activated carbon adsorption mesh to treat the waste gas in the pow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earing drying device, the problem of waste gas pollution during the drying process of oil-impregnated bearings was solved, and the waste gas purification and bearing drying efficiency were improved.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a quick drying device for powder metallurgy oil-retaining bearing machining, and particularly relates to the technical field of powder metallurgy oil-retaining bearing machining, the quick drying device comprises a drying box, two inner walls of the drying box are fixedly provided with gas collecting plates, the gas collecting plates are hollow, the surfaces of the gas collecting plates are provided with a plurality of exhaust holes, and the exhaust holes are communicated with the drying box. A plurality of grid plates are fixedly distributed between the two gas collecting plates from top to bottom, an air heater is fixedly installed on the rear wall of the drying box, a connecting pipe is arranged at the output end of the air heater, the outer walls of the two gas collecting plates communicate with branch pipes, a conveying pipe communicates between the two branch pipes, and a waste gas treatment structure is arranged at the top of the drying box. According to the oil bearing drying device, the oil bearing can be evenly and rapidly dried, the drying efficiency is improved, in the drying process, organic waste gas volatilized by the oil bearing can be adsorbed, influences on operators are avoided, and the using effect is improved.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earing processing technology, and more specifically, to a rapid drying device for pow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earing processing. Background Technology

[0002] Pow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earings are sintered bodies made using powder metallurgy. Their main raw material is metal powder. These bearings have a porous structure with lubricating oil stored in the pores. During operation, they can automatically lubricate themselves through frictional heat generation and suction, reducing friction and wear.

[0003] Currently, pow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earings need to be dried after production and processing to reduce their internal moisture content and improve their performance.

[0004] However, currently, when hot air drying is performed on oil-impregnated bearings, flue gas containing organic waste gas is generated. If this waste gas is discharged directly without treatment, it will not only pollute the environment but also endanger the health of operators. In view of this, this utility model proposes a rapid drying device for powder metallurgy oil-impregnated bearing processing. Utility Model Content

[0005] In order to overcome the above-mentioned defects of the prior art, the present invention provides a rapid drying device for processing oil-impregnated bearings in powder metallurgy, so as to solve the problems mentioned in the background art.

[0006]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a rapid drying device for processing oil-impregnated bearings in powder metallurgy, comprising a drying chamber, wherein two inner walls of the drying chamber are fixedly installed with air collecting plates, the air collecting plates are hollow and have several exhaust holes on their surface, and several grid plates are fixedly distributed between the two air collecting plates from top to bottom, a hot air blower is fixedly installed on the rear wall of the drying chamber, the output end of the hot air blower is provided with a connecting pipe, the outer walls of the two air collecting plates are connected to branch pipes, and a conveying pipe is connected between the two branch pipes, the output end of the hot air blower is fixedly connected to the connecting pipe, the branch pipe extends to the outside of the drying chamber, the two ends of the conveying pipe are respectively connected to the corresponding branch pipes, and one end of the connecting pipe is connected to the conveying pipe.

[0007] As can be seen, the hot air blower delivers hot air through pipes and then diverts it into the interior of the corresponding air collecting plate. Finally, it is evenly discharged through several exhaust holes on the air collecting plate, which quickly dries the oil-impregnated bearings on the grid plate and improves the drying efficiency of the oil-impregnated bearings.

[0008] To treat the exhaust gas generated during the drying of oil-impregnated bearings, preferably, the top of the drying chamber is equipped with an exhaust gas treatment structure. This structure includes a gas collection hood installed on top of and connected to the drying chamber. An air suction pump is installed on one side of the hood. The air suction pump has an intake pipe and an exhaust pipe at its intake and exhaust ends, respectively. A treatment chamber is fixedly installed on the outer wall of the drying chamber. Two activated carbon adsorption nets are horizontally installed inside the treatment chamber. An exhaust pipe connects to the bottom of the treatment chamber. The air suction pump is fixedly installed on top of the drying chamber, with its intake end connected to the exhaust pipe and its exhaust end connected to the installation pipe. One end of the installation pipe is connected to the treatment chamber.

[0009] To facilitate the disassembly and cleaning of the activated carbon adsorption mesh inside the treatment box, preferably, the outer wall of the treatment box has two installation ports. The two activated carbon adsorption meshes are respectively disassembled and assembled with the treatment box through the installation ports. A sealing plate is installed inside the installation port. The sealing plate is fixedly connected to one end of the activated carbon adsorption mesh. The sealing plate is installed inside the installation port by screws, and the sealing plate has a groove.

[0010] To improve the sealing effect of the drying oven, preferably, the drying oven has a door hinged to its surface, and a sealing ring is affixed to the surface of the door.

[0011] The technical effects and advantages of this utility model are as follows:

[0012] 1. By setting up a waste gas treatment structure, the air suction pump draws in air containing organic waste gas from inside the drying box through the air collection hood. The air is then transported to the inside of the treatment box through the air supply pipe and the installation pipe. The organic pollutants in the waste gas are adsorbed and treated by two activated carbon adsorption nets. The purified air is finally discharged through the exhaust pipe connected to the bottom of the treatment box, avoiding the impact of organic waste gas on the operators. At the same time, this structure allows the operators to easily disassemble and clean the activated carbon adsorption nets inside the drying box.

[0013] 2. Hot air is delivered to the inside of the conveying pipe through the connecting pipe by the hot air blower. The hot air is split to both sides in the conveying pipe, and enters the corresponding air collecting plate through two branch pipes. Finally, it is discharged through several exhaust holes on the surface of the air collecting plate. The hot air flowing from bottom to top can perform uniform and rapid drying treatment on the oil-impregnated bearings on the grid plate, improve the uniformity and scale of oil-impregnated bearing drying, and improve drying efficiency. [0021] As attached Figure 1-5 The device shown is a rapid drying device for processing oil-impregnated bearings in powder metallurgy. It includes a drying chamber 1. Two air collecting plates 2 are fixedly installed on the two inner walls of the drying chamber 1. The air collecting plates 2 are hollow and have several exhaust holes 3 on their surface. Several grid plates 4 are fixedly distributed from top to bottom between the two air collecting plates 2. A hot air blower 5 is fixedly installed on the rear wall of the drying chamber 1. A connecting pipe 6 is provided at the output end of the hot air blower 5. Branch pipes 7 are connected to the outer walls of the two air collecting plates 2. A conveying pipe 8 is connected between the two branch pipes 7. The output end of the hot air blower 5 is fixedly connected to the connecting pipe 6. The branch pipes 7 extend to the outside of the drying chamber 1. The two ends of the conveying pipe 8 are respectively connected to the corresponding branch pipes 7. One end of the connecting pipe 6 is connected to the conveying pipe 8.

[0022] Specifically, in this structure, the oil-impregnated bearing to be dried is placed inside the drying chamber 1 and located on multiple grid plates 4. At this time, after the hot air blower 5 is started, hot air is delivered to the inside of the conveying pipe 8 through the connecting pipe 6. The hot air is split to both sides through the conveying pipe 8 and enters the corresponding air collecting plate 2 through two branch pipes 7. The air collecting plate 2 is hollow. After the hot air enters the inside of the air collecting plate 2, it is finally discharged through multiple exhaust holes 3. Since several grid plates 4 are fixedly distributed between two air collecting plates 2, the hot air flows from bottom to top, and performs uniform and rapid drying treatment on the oil-impregnated bearing on the grid plate 4.

[0023] In this embodiment, as shown in the appendix Figure 1 , 3 As shown, a waste gas treatment structure is provided on the top of the drying chamber 1. The waste gas treatment structure includes a gas collection hood 9, which is installed on the top of the drying chamber 1 and connected to the drying chamber 1. A suction pump 10 is provided on one side of the gas collection hood 9. The suction end and exhaust end of the suction pump 10 are respectively provided with a gas delivery pipe 11 and an installation pipe 12. A treatment box 13 is fixedly installed on the outer wall of the drying chamber 1. Two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 are horizontally installed inside the treatment box 13. An exhaust pipe 15 is connected to the bottom end of the treatment box 13. The suction pump 10 is fixedly installed on the top of the drying chamber 1. The suction end of the suction pump 10 is connected to the gas delivery pipe 11, and the exhaust end is connected to the installation pipe 12. One end of the installation pipe 12 is connected to the treatment box 13.

[0024] Specifically, in this structure, during the drying process of the oil-impregnated bearing, some organic waste gas is generated. At this time, the suction pump 10 is started, which draws in the air inside the drying chamber 1 through the gas collection hood 9 and transports it to the interior of the treatment chamber 13 through the air supply pipe 11 and the installation pipe 12. The organic waste gas contained in the air enters the interior of the treatment chamber 13 along with the air. On the one hand, it can promote the flow of hot air inside the drying chamber 1, and on the other hand, it can transport the waste gas to the interior of the treatment chamber 13. The waste gas is treated by two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 and finally discharged through the exhaust pipe 15, thereby avoiding the impact of organic waste gas on the operators.

[0025] In this embodiment, as shown in the appendix Figure 3 , 4 As shown, the outer wall of the treatment box 13 has two mounting ports 16. Two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 are respectively installed and removed from the treatment box 13 through the mounting ports 16. A sealing plate 17 is installed inside the mounting port 16. The sealing plate 17 is fixedly connected to one end of the activated carbon adsorption net 14. The sealing plate 17 is installed inside the mounting port 16 by screws, and a groove 18 is provided on the sealing plate 17.

[0026] Specifically, in this structure, when it is necessary to remove and clean the activated carbon adsorption net 14, the screws at the sealing plate 17 can be removed, and the sealing plate 17 can be pulled to one side through the pull groove 18, so that the sealing plate 17 can pull the two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 out of the inside of the processing box 13 through the installation port 16, thus completing the disassembly of the activated carbon adsorption net 14.

[0027] Similarly, the two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 are installed inside the treatment box 13 through the installation port 16, and the sealing plate 17 is sealed inside the installation port 16 by screws to complete the installation of the activated carbon adsorption nets 14.

[0028] In this embodiment, as shown in the appendix Figure 1 , 5 As shown, a door 19 is hinged to the surface of the drying oven 1, and a sealing ring 20 is affixed to the surface of the door 19.

[0029] Specifically, the door 19 can create a good drying environment inside the drying oven 1, and the sealing ring 20 on the surface of the door 19 can increase the sealing with the drying oven 1 and reduce heat loss.

[0030] Working principle of this utility model:

[0031] This application provides a rapid drying device for processing oil-impregnated bearings in powder metallurgy. In specific use, first open the hinged door 19 on the surface of the drying chamber 1, place the oil-impregnated bearing to be dried on multiple grid plates 4 inside the drying chamber 1, and close the door 19. Since the sealing ring 20 is pasted on the surface of the door 19, it can increase the sealing with the drying chamber 1, reduce heat loss, and create a good drying environment inside the drying chamber 1.

[0032] Start the hot air blower 5. The hot air blower 5 delivers hot air to the inside of the conveying pipe 8 through the connecting pipe 6. The hot air is split to both sides in the conveying pipe 8 and enters the corresponding air collecting plate 2 through two branch pipes 7. Because the air collecting plate 2 is hollow, the hot air is discharged through several exhaust holes 3 on the surface of the air collecting plate 2. Because several grid plates 4 are fixedly distributed between the two air collecting plates 2, the hot air flows from bottom to top, and performs uniform and rapid drying treatment on the oil-impregnated bearings on the grid plates 4.

[0033] Organic waste gas is generated during the drying process of oil-impregnated bearings. The suction pump 10 is started, and the suction pump 10 draws in the air containing organic waste gas from the inside of the drying box 1 through the air collection hood 9. The air is transported to the inside of the treatment box 13 through the air supply pipe 11 and the installation pipe 12. This process promotes the flow of hot air inside the drying box 1 on the one hand, and transports the waste gas to the treatment box 13 for treatment on the other hand.

[0034] After the air containing organic waste gas enters the treatment box 13, it passes through two horizontally installed activated carbon adsorption nets 14 in sequence. The activated carbon adsorption nets 14 use their adsorption characteristics to adsorb the organic pollutants in the waste gas. The purified air is finally discharged through the exhaust pipe 15 connected to the bottom of the treatment box 13 to avoid the organic waste gas from affecting the operators.

[0035] When it is necessary to remove and clean the activated carbon adsorption net 14, remove the screws at the sealing plate 17, and pull the sealing plate 17 to one side through the pull groove 18 on the sealing plate 17 so that the sealing plate 17 pulls the two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 out of the treatment box 13 through the installation port 16 to complete the removal. During installation, install the two activated carbon adsorption nets 14 inside the treatment box 13 through the installation port 16, and then use screws to seal the sealing plate 17 inside the installation port 16 to complete the installation of the activated carbon adsorption nets 14.
